
The 'BioUrban 2.0' air purification system in Puebla, Mexico. Biomitech created an artificial tree, which through live algae, carries out a process of photosynthesis, doing the equivalent to what 368 natural trees would do. — AFP
PUEBLA, Mexico: Trees are one of the best things we have to clean the Earth's air, but they have certain drawbacks: they need time and space to grow.
Enter the BioUrban, an artificial tree that sucks up as much air pollution as 368 real trees.
